Pros & cons

BMW 118i

  • Efficient for its class at 5.5 L/100 km
  • Practical five-seat hatchback with a 360 L trunk
  • Easy to drive in the city thanks to FWD and compact size
  • Good value in its segment at about 35,000

Volvo V40

  • 5-star safety rating for strong protection
  • Efficient for its class at 5.4 L/100 km, great for city use
  • Quick 0–100 km/h in 6.7 s with 190 hp and 400 Nm for confident passes
  • Seats 5 and priced around 30000, offering good value in its segment

Verdict

Pick BMW 118i if…
Efficiency & everyday ease
BMW 118i is the choice if fuel economy and city-friendly driving are your priority.
Pick Volvo V40 if…
More power
Volvo V40 puts out 190 hp vs 140 — meaningfully quicker and more confident on motorways.
